with cloud platforms (Azure, GCP, or AWS preferred) Strong understanding of software security principles and modern secure development practices Knowledge of automated testing frameworks (e.g. Jest, Testing Library, Cypress, Cucumber) Familiarity with tools like npm, Webpack, and source control systems like Git Experience with Agile delivery methodologies and iterative development Ability to manage multiple priorities and deliver high-quality outcomes More ❯
such as Jenkins, Maven, Kubernetes, Terraform Hands-on experience with cloud-based build and release automation (e.g., Azure or GCP) Knowledge of agile development and test automation (e.g. Jest, Cucumber, Cypress) Familiarity with development tools such as npm, Webpack, etc. Strong team player with excellent communication and collaboration skills Ability to challenge ideas constructively and adapt thinking where appropriate About More ❯
practices Hands-on experience with Docker or containerisation technologies Experience building and deploying via CI/CD pipelines Testing expertise with tools such as Jest, Testing Library, Cypress, or Cucumber Familiarity with DevOps tools such as Jenkins, Terraform, Maven, Kubernetes Knowledge of release automation and build tools (e.g., Azure Pipelines, GCP, Nexus) Ability to work across the full software development More ❯
Cassandra, Redis ,Apache Druid • Solid experience in REST APIs, GraphQL & gRPC • Strong hands-on experience in GitHub/GitLab and testing tools/frameworks such as SonarQube, xUnit, Postman, Cucumber, Polaris, Blackduck. • Strong hands-on experience in any one or more cloud technologies such as Azure/GCP/AWS. • Strong knowledge in data structures, algorithms, design patterns & Clean architecture More ❯
end automated tests. Knowledge of designing Acceptance Test Criteria and maintaining automated tests. Experience with CI/CD tools like GitLab, Team City, Jenkins. Experience with BDD frameworks like Cucumber and performance testing tools like J-Meter. Knowledge of Non-Functional testing including Performance, Load, Stress, and Security testing. Understanding of FIX Client/FIX API automation. Knowledge of trade More ❯
Cypress Good knowledge of relational databases such as MySQL and PostgreSQL including data modelling, SQL scripts, store procedures Shift to the left: Functional test automation (API testing, UI testing cucumber, nightwatch ) Nice to have skills: AWS Knowledge of Open Source BPMN workflow engines (Camunda, Activiti or Flowable) Experience on a front-end javascript framework such as react, angular or vue.js More ❯
Southampton, Hampshire, United Kingdom Hybrid / WFH Options
Materialise NV
for authentication and authorization Infrastructure-as-code tools, such as Terraform, for deployments to production and non-production cloud environments Behaviour-Driven Development and automation with tools such as Cucumber, SpecFlow and Serenity Test-Driven Development and Test-Driven Design AsciiDoctor and Markdown for the creation of technical documentation Supporting software products in customer environments Leveraging cloud services and offerings More ❯
Bristol, Avon, South West, United Kingdom Hybrid / WFH Options
Hargreaves Lansdown
a team Adopts a logical, analytical, and methodical approach to problem solving Nice to Have A background in finance/banking Understanding of TDD and BDD Test automation with Cucumber and Selenium Understanding of object-oriented programming (OOP) model principles and application design patterns Frontend Web development, HTML, CSS. Knowledge of using JIRA and other Atlassian products Why Us? Here More ❯
Employment Type: Contract, Part Time, Work From Home
Bristol, Gloucestershire, United Kingdom Hybrid / WFH Options
Hargreaves Lansdown PLC
a team Adopts a logical, analytical, and methodical approach to problem solving Nice to Have A background in finance/banking Understanding of TDD and BDD Test automation with Cucumber and Selenium Understanding of object-oriented programming (OOP) model principles and application design patterns Frontend Web development, HTML, CSS. Knowledge of using JIRA and other Atlassian products Why us? Here More ❯
RESTful, experience of REST design and implementation). Knowledge of kubernetes API managers and WebLogic. Experience with OpenShift Container platform, 3scale API and KeyCloak. Testing frameworks and TDD (like Cucumber or J unit). Databases: Relational (Oracle). Coding in adherence to the standards of the application in question. Maintaining, tuning and repairing applications to keep them performing according to More ❯
and implementation). understanding of API security protocols Knowledge of Kubernetes, API managers and WebLogic. Experience with OpenShift Container platform, 3scale API and KeyCloak. Testing frameworks and TDD (like Cucumber or Junit). Databases: Relational (Oracle). Coding in adherence to the standards of the application in question. Maintaining, tuning and repairing applications to keep them performing according to technical More ❯
and drive to learn new things and build new solutions Strong communication, time management, organization, attention to detail Experience with writing extensive unit and integration testing using Junit 4+, Cucumber, Mockito, AssertJ, Jest and Cypress Strong Java programming skills Minimum of 5 years of practical software development experience Robust object-oriented design pattern knowledge and implementation experience using Java Advanced More ❯
using Load Runner or similar (not mandatory) Experience in developing custom regression test suites using any of the programming languages Python, Perl, Shell scripting, Java, MySQL Experience of using Cucumber and creating test frameworks Experience of creating detailed test plan and test strategy. Liaising with the client test leads/managers and align the test strategy/plan created with More ❯
branching, merging, and pull requests. - API Development: Proficiency in designing and developing RESTful APIs. Desirable Skills: - Behavior Driven Design (BDD): Familiarity with BDD principles and tools like SpecFlow or Cucumber for writing and automating tests. - Elastic Search: Experience with Elastic Search for implementing search functionality and managing large datasets. - Docker: Knowledge of containerization using Docker for creating, deploying, and managing More ❯
end to end tests with an Automated Framework. Skilled in using CI/CD tooling such as GitLab, Team City, Jenkins. Experience of using BDD testing frameworks such as Cucumber and performance/NFR testing tool J-Meter or similar. Non-Functional testing including, Performance, Load, Stress and Security testing Knowledge of FIX Client/FIX API automation. Understanding of More ❯
Strong skills in automation tools (Selenium, Cypress, Playwright, TestComplete). Programming/scripting with Java, JavaScript, or similar . CI/CD tools (GitLab, Jenkins, TeamCity). BDD frameworks (Cucumber) and performance tools (JMeter). Non-functional testing (Performance, Load, Stress, Security). Strong collaboration and communication in Agile/SAFe environments. Desirable Experience in financial services/trading systems. More ❯
etc Experience with cloud environments such as GCP, AWS or Azure Software Development best practice such as SOLID, ACID and OO design principles Desirable: Writing integration tests (such as Cucumber) and understanding behaviour-driven development (BDD) principles Demonstrable front-end (React) experience in a full stack implementation context Working within an Agile environment Experience integrating with e-commerce platforms such More ❯
will have some knowledge of the below tools. Proficiency of all of the below is not required. Programming Languages: Python, Java Frameworks/Libraries: Spring (Boot, Batch, Cache, Web), Cucumber (Testing framework for BDD), Drools (Business rules management system), Spark (Big Data processing framework) Build/CI/CD Tools: Gradle (Build automation tool), Jenkins (CI/CD automation server More ❯
following technologies: SpringBoot, Gradle, Terraform, Ansible, GitHub/GitFlow, PCF/OCP/Kubernetes technologies, Artifactory, IaC Experience with Test Driven Development (TDD) Experience with Behavior Driven Development (BDD, Cucumber test framework) Experience writing unit and service level tests to ensure adequate code coverage (JUnits) Drools Proven skills in high availability and scalability design, as well as performance monitoring Experience More ❯
support continuous integration and deployment, and enhance solution resilience to handle disruptions. About You Automation Tool Integration and Management: Design, implement, and maintain automation workflows using tools such as Cucumber/WebDriver IO, Playwright, Postman, Selenium, SoapUI, Cypress, PowerShell, and Azure Automation to streamline infrastructure provisioning, configuration management, and operational tasks across cloud environments. Infrastructure as Code (IaC) Development: Design More ❯
like Git. Excellent problem-solving skills and attention to detail. Strong communication and collaboration skills. Preferred Skills : Experience in Agile/Scrum development environments. Familiarity with BDD tools like Cucumber or SpecFlow. Familiarity with project management software such as JIRA Experience mentoring and supporting colleague development Interview process This will be a two stage interview process consisting of a competency More ❯
Birmingham, West Midlands, England, United Kingdom Hybrid / WFH Options
HR CAREERS & NATIONWIDE RECRUITMENT SERVICE
and Google Material Design Collaborate in Agile teams with Product Owners and QA Engineers Enhance UI/UX across customer-facing financial platforms Embed quality via test frameworks, including Cucumber and Allure Deliver seamless front-end functionality for mortgage and banking clients What You’ll Bring: Commercial experience in Angular , JavaScript , and TypeScript Experience working in financial services , mortgage lending More ❯
Coventry, West Midlands, United Kingdom Hybrid / WFH Options
HR Careers & Nationwide Recruitment Service Ltd
and Google Material Design Collaborate in Agile teams with Product Owners and QA Engineers Enhance UI/UX across customer-facing financial platforms Embed quality via test frameworks including Cucumber and Allure Deliver seamless front-end functionality for mortgage and banking clients What Youll Bring: Commercial experience in Angular , JavaScript , and TypeScript Experience working in financial services , mortgage lending , or More ❯
Swindon, Wiltshire, South West, United Kingdom Hybrid / WFH Options
HR Careers & Nationwide Recruitment Service Ltd
and Google Material Design Collaborate in Agile teams with Product Owners and QA Engineers Enhance UI/UX across customer-facing financial platforms Embed quality via test frameworks including Cucumber and Allure Deliver seamless front-end functionality for mortgage and banking clients What Youll Bring: Commercial experience in Angular , JavaScript , and TypeScript Experience working in financial services , mortgage lending , or More ❯
Newbury, Berkshire, United Kingdom Hybrid / WFH Options
Gamma Communications plc
design Experience using version control (ideally Git) Experience working in an Agile methodology Familiarity with CI/CD and related tooling Experience of test automation tooling (such as JUnit, Cucumber, Selenium) Experience with Jira or a similar work tracking tool What do we offer you? At Gamma, we believe in work-life balance, which is why we offer 25 days More ❯